Abstract

A new Schiff base, 2-[Z-(hydroxyimino)methyl]phenol (SAOX), has been synthesized from salicylaldehyde and hydroxylamine hydrochloride. 2-[E-(hydroxyimino)methyl] phenolmanganate(II) [Mn(SAOX)2] was prepared from sulphate salt of Mn(II) in an alcoholic medium. The chemical structures of the SAOX and [Mn(SAOX)2] were confirmed by various spectroscopic studies like IR, 1H NMR, ESR, ESI-mass spectra, elemental analysis, molar conductance. On the basis of elemental and spectral studies, six coordinated geometry was assigned to these complexes. The free Schiff base and its complexes have been tested for their antibacterial activity by using disc diffusion method and the results discussed.
